I'll chime in, since I've only been using Chandler for about 6 weeks.
And I'll admit, I haven't checked out the newest pages on the website.
When I started, I wanted a tutorial on:
- creating a new Collection
- adding an item to that collection
- configuring items
- working with the Calendar views
That's all ... as a raw newbie, I didn't want info on setting up a
Hub account, publishing / subscribing to Hub collections, configuring
e-mail ... I knew I'd want to learn that, but not right away.
As of early July, the Getting Started page was bogged down in all
sorts of intermediate and advanced features, without enough screen
shots of the simple stuff.
Another problem with that page (back then) was that is was completely
un-illustrated. Newbies need lots of screen shots, with call-outs so
they know what they are seeing.
Once people can do the basics with Chandler, then it's time to go to
the User Stories ... "oh, *that's* what Feature XXX can be used for!"
Demos on video are good for getting people to download software, but
much less so on learning to use it. I may be old-fashioned, but I
learn far better from static text.
